Salut;
J'ai un boucle for
Je veux que les indices i = 20 ET i = 24 ne s'exécutent pas càd seront ignorés toujours en utilisant le boucle For .Code:
1
2
3
4 for i = 1 : 30 TRAITEMENT; end
Merci
Version imprimable
Salut;
J'ai un boucle for
Je veux que les indices i = 20 ET i = 24 ne s'exécutent pas càd seront ignorés toujours en utilisant le boucle For .Code:
1
2
3
4 for i = 1 : 30 TRAITEMENT; end
Merci
Bonjour
Si tu veux que ton traitement ne s'exécute pas uniquement pour ces deux indices, tu pourrais te servir dans ta boucle d'une instruction conditionnelle du type :
Ca me parait assez bateau m'enfin...Citation:
if (i == 20 || i == 24) {}
else {TRAITEMENT;}
et si on est à optimiser, alors il suffit de diviser la boucle en 3, pour ne pas faire les tests à chaque tour de boucle...